It’s easy to imagine the perfect chili for a game day gathering or a chilly winter night in your head. It has beans, ground beef, tomatoes, cheese and maybe even sour cream. But, in certain parts of the country, chili looks totally different, like in Texas.
While this regional chili style has no beans, it will still come out satisfying for those who love chili, whether you eat it alone or atop a hot dog or Frito pie. Beanless chili is just one of the most iconic Texas dishes you can make at home.
